.TH "PAPI_get_component_info" 3 "Thu Feb 27 2020" "Version 6.0.0.0" "PAPI" \" -*- nroff -*- .ad l .nh .SH NAME PAPI_get_component_info \- .PP get information about a specific software component .SH SYNOPSIS .br .PP .SH "Detailed Description" .PP .PP .nf @param cidx Component index This function returns a pointer to a structure containing detailed information about a specific software component in the PAPI library. This includes versioning information, preset and native event information, and more. For full details, see @ref PAPI_component_info_t. @par Examples: .fi .PP .PP .nf const PAPI_component_info_t *cmpinfo = NULL; if (PAPI_library_init(PAPI_VER_CURRENT) != PAPI_VER_CURRENT) exit(1); if ((cmpinfo = PAPI_get_component_info(0)) == NULL) exit(1); printf("This component supports %d Preset Events and %d Native events\&.\n", cmpinfo->num_preset_events, cmpinfo->num_native_events); * .fi .PP .PP \fBSee Also:\fP .RS 4 \fBPAPI_get_executable_info\fP .PP \fBPAPI_get_hardware_info\fP .PP \fBPAPI_get_dmem_info\fP .PP \fBPAPI_get_opt\fP .PP \fBPAPI_component_info_t\fP .RE .PP .SH "Author" .PP Generated automatically by Doxygen for PAPI from the source code\&.